Golden Globes 2025: Vintage glamour reigns supreme on the red carpet

It’s like a love letter to the past.

Hollywood loves a good sequel, but this year’s Golden Globes red carpet proved that the best storylines come from the archives.

From Ariana Grande’s Audrey Hepburn homage to Kylie Jenner’s jaw-dropping revival of a shimmering Versace chainmail gown, the night was a masterclass in the art of the comeback. It was a night of reviving memories, making statements, and breathing new life into decades-old couture.

Ariana Grande stepped out in a vintage Givenchy gown from 1966 that could have come straight from Breakfast at Tiffany’s. The pale yellow strapless dress, decorated with delicate floral details, was paired with opera gloves and a sleek updo. The simple yet elegant look was a perfect nod to Audrey Hepburn and a fitting choice for Ariana as she transitions from pop star to leading actress in Wicked.

Zendaya, nominated for her role in Challengers, turned heads in a custom Louis Vuitton tangerine gown. The dress featured a dramatic bustle and train, inspired by Old Hollywood glamour. The look, as a fan pointed out, is like a subtle tribute to Joyce Bryant, a groundbreaking singer and actress often called “The Bronze Blond Bombshell.” The gown also drew from the work of Zelda Wynn Valdez, the designer behind many of Bryant’s iconic looks. Zendaya completed the outfit with Bulgari diamonds, matching heels, and a chic bob.

Kylie Jenner stunned in a silver chainmail Versace dress from the Spring 1999 collection, famously worn by Elizabeth Hurley at the 1999 CFDA Awards. While Kylie and Timothée Chalamet didn’t walk the red carpet together, the couple were seen during the evening, mirroring Hurley’s original appearance with Hugh Grant and highlighting the enduring appeal of this iconic look.


Ayo Edebiri had her own fashion moment by channeling Julia Roberts’ iconic menswear-inspired look from the 1990 Globes. Wearing a custom gray Loewe suit with sharp shoulders and wide-leg trousers, Ayo’s outfit was a modern twist on Roberts’ famous ensemble. Instead of a tie, she added her own edge with a bold gold feather necklace and sleek silver grills. Loose auburn waves completed the look, nodding to Julia’s signature style. It was a thoughtful tribute that felt fresh, playful, and entirely her own.


Anya Taylor-Joy stepped onto the 2025 Golden Globes red carpet in an archival pale pink Dior Couture gown that felt straight out of a dream. The dress featured soft draping and was paired with its original fringed shawl, adding an extra touch of vintage charm.
